The Tasmanian Government continues to force through its legislation to facilitate the Bell Bay Pulp Mill, in Northern Tasmania, near Launceston.
Now the issue which has arisen is the suitability (or otherwise) of the firm of consultants selected to review the proposal. This is likely to be the least of everybody's worries.
Surely the real issue is how the Government itself is not accountable for the proposal; and the extraordinary legislative protection which the Government is offering Gunns Limited, the huge forestry company which is pushing for the proposal.
